Sergey Volkov Cosmonaut Biography
Born on April 1 year in Chuguev, the Kharkov region. Russian astronaut. The son of the astronaut Alexander Volkov. The world's first cosmonaut in the second generation. Hero of the Russian Federation Sergey Volkov was born on April 1 in the Chuguev of the Kharkov region. Father - Alexander Alexandrovich Volkov, Soviet and Russian astronaut. Hero of the Soviet Union Mother - Anna Nikolaevna Volkova in the girlishness of the Wheeler, librarian.
The younger brother is Dmitry Aleksandrovich Volkov Rod. For the first time, Sergey Volkov got to the airfield at the age of 4 years, when his father was still an instructor in the Chuguevsky school of pilots. Since there was no one to leave the child with at home, his father took him with him, then he first got into the cabin of a combat aircraft. In November, he successfully completed the two-year training course of astronauts and received the qualification of the Cosmonaut tester. In the period from January 5 to July, Volkov was trained in the flight program at the International Space Station as part of a group of astronauts.
From September to February, he studied as the commander of the Soyuz TMA ship. Sergei Volkov was an understudy of the first cosmonaut of Brazil Markos Pontes, who made a space flight on the TMA-8 union from March 30 to April 8. During his flight, the astronaut made two exits into outer space, each of which became an important stage in his mission. The first exit took place on July 10 and lasted 6 hours 18 minutes.
During this exit, the astronauts conducted a thorough inspection and mechanical cutting of one of the five locks connecting the descent apparatus of CA and the useful load of the PAS of the Soyuz TMA spacecraft. This was an important event that allows to ensure further safety of working with the device. In the process of work, they removed Pyobolt, which became part of the necessary technical manipulations.
The second exit took place on July 15 and lasted 5 hours 54 minutes. This time, the astronauts installed the target block and the anchor site on the transition compartment of the SMSDA service module. These actions were aimed at improving the functionality of the module and its preparation for the next stages of experiments. In addition, they installed scientific equipment for the “surge” experiment in the working compartment of the same module, which opened up new horizons for research in the field of astrophysics and other scientific disciplines.

A feature of the expedition to the ISS was that for the first time both Russian astronauts in its composition were newcomers in space. Previously, this happened only in the very first group flights in the X years.

During his second flight, the astronaut made one exit to the outer space, which took place on August 3 and lasted 6 hours 22 minutes. During this exit, the astronauts installed a platform on the outer surface of the Pierce module, which housed three containers for the Biorisk experiment. This experiment was aimed at studying the influence of cosmic conditions on living organisms, which is an important aspect for future long missions.
In addition, in the process of release, the Kedr microsatnik was launched, which also contributed to the development of scientific research. The flight duration was 6 hours 12 minutes 5 seconds.
